Dual vs. Triple Camera Setup
The most significant difference between the two phones is the number of cameras they have. The iPhone 13 has a dual-camera setup, while the iPhone 13 Pro has a triple-camera setup. The dual-camera setup in the iPhone 13 comprises a wide and an ultra-wide lens. On the other hand, the triple-camera setup in the iPhone 13 Pro has a wide, an ultra-wide, and a telephoto lens.
ProRes Video Recording
One of the most significant differences between the two phones is that the iPhone 13 Pro supports ProRes video recording while the iPhone 13 does not. ProRes is a high-quality video codec that is used in professional video editing. With ProRes support, the iPhone 13 Pro can record high-quality videos that are suitable for professional-level editing.
Optical Zoom
Another significant difference between the two phones is the optical zoom capability. The iPhone 13 has a digital zoom of up to 5x, while the iPhone 13 Pro has a 3x optical zoom and a digital zoom of up to 10x. Optical zoom is much better than digital zoom as it zooms in on the subject without losing any clarity or detail, while digital zoom crops the image and reduces the quality.

LIDAR Scanner
The iPhone 13 Pro is the only phone in the iPhone 13 series that comes with a LiDAR scanner. LiDAR stands for Light Detection and Ranging, and it uses lasers to measure the distance between the camera and the subject. This technology enables the iPhone 13 Pro to capture stunning portraits and augmented reality (AR) experiences.
